Respublika (Kazakh newspaper)
Respublika (Russian: Республика – деловое оброзение) or Golos Respubliki (Voice of the Republic) is or was a weekly Kazakhstani newspaper. Founded by Irina Petrushova in 2000, the paper is known for its reporting on government corruption. It was ordered to closure in 2002 and in May 2005 by the Ministry of Culture, Information and Sports, but continued to publish under a variety of titles. In late 2012, before the anniversary of the Mangystau riots, Kazakhstani authorities raided and searched Respublika's office and again suspended its publication, pending a verdict on criminal charges.
